Lunatask Premium is an all-in-one to-do list, notetaker, habit and mood tracker, daily journal, and Pomodoro timer. And it only has one job: to keep you focused and on task. It features an open platform to integrate it with other tools and apps. It offers state-of-the-art security, and it’s compatible with a wide range of operating systems, including Windows, macOS, and Linux.
